Those who have always wanted to give weaving a try but were unsure of how to get started are invited to learn the fundamentals of the craft during an online Annapolis workshop.
The class, which is for beginners, will use a variety of simple methods to teach the basics of weaving. The event is being held by ArtFarm. It is intended for adults, and it will use materials that can be easily found in area craft shops.
The learners will discover that weaving can be surprisingly easy, and the techniques may be used to craft everything from wall hangings and other decor to clothing. The students will be taught how to prepare a cardboard loom, along with at least three basic techniques. They will experiment with color and texture, and the session will wrap up with a discussion of how to clean up and finish their project.
The host of the activity has prepared a list of supplies that the attendees will be able to purchase along with their registration, or they can choose to pick them up on their own.
